Added by on 2014-12-14

[Total: 0   Average: 0/5]You must sign in to vote Stopped off the side of the road on Hwy 79 between Tucson and Phoenix. Filmed a quick tour of the thriving Arizona desert.

Leave a Reply

Your email address will not be published. Required fields are marked *



This site uses Akismet to reduce spam. Learn how your comment data is processed.